Application
- Lithium-Ion Battery Electrolytes: Serves as a critical component of lithium hexafluorophosphate (LiPF6) or as a direct electrolyte salt in high-performance energy storage systems.
- Chemical Synthesis & Catalysis: Acts as a versatile precursor or counterion in the synthesis of organometallic compounds, ionic liquids, and specialty catalysts.
- Pharmaceutical Intermediates: Employed in the development and manufacturing of active pharmaceutical ingredients (APIs) requiring stable fluorinated anions.
- Electroplating & Surface Treatment: Used in specialized electroplating baths for depositing metal coatings with enhanced properties.
- Research & Development: A fundamental reagent in academic and industrial R&D for materials science and electrochemistry studies.

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ed and under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ent degradation.
